Low-Cost Trauma Counseling Britain : Accessing Accessible Help
Seeking qualified support for trauma can feel difficult, especially when factoring in the economic aspect. Fortunately, increasingly, options for budget-friendly trauma care are emerging within the UK. While private sessions can be expensive , several avenues exist to lower the cost . These include:
- Non-profit organisations that offer discounted services.
- Newly-qualified therapists providing sessions at lower rates.
- Group counseling sessions, which are often significantly less than individual therapy .
- NHS psychological services, although waiting times can sometimes be long.
- Online services connecting individuals with budget counselors .
It’s vital to research these options thoroughly and evaluate what appears right for your personal needs . Don't hesitate to contact with local agencies for guidance and assistance .
Understanding Trauma and PTSD: UK Resources and Help
Experiencing some shocking event can leave permanent scars, potentially leading to PTSD. In the United Kingdom, numerous services are available to provide help for those suffering with trauma and its effects. Groups like Mind, The Samaritans, and PTSD UK deliver valuable resources and private support lines. The NHS also delivers psychological services, including treatment, although access can differ. Public websites and boroughs frequently list further resources – investigating online using trauma therapy York keywords like "PTSD resources UK" can be useful. Don’t wait to get assistance; recovery is obtainable with the necessary treatment.
